Secure deduplication for big data with efficient dynamic ownership updates

2021 
Abstract With the explosive growth of data on the internet, the trend is for users to store these large amounts of data on the cloud. To protect the privacy of data, users need to encrypt their data before uploading them to the cloud. This brings a big challenge for cloud to perform deduplication. In order to tackle this challenge, we design a secure deduplication scheme for big data with efficient dynamic ownership updates. The proposed scheme can efficiently support user enrollment and revocation. We adopt a new locating technique to effectively locate the re-encrypted data block. As a result, only a small proportion of data needs to be re-encrypted. When one user deletes or updates one file, this user will lost the access to the original data. We also provide the security analysis and experimental evaluation results for the proposed scheme.
